Gin Rummy is a wonderful two-person card game that's surprisingly straightforward to learn . The aim is to create melds of cards , which are groups of three or more cards of the same rank (like three Ladies) or sequences of three or more cards in the same family (like four Red Suits). Participants receive cards from a draw pile and put down unwanted cards hoping to reduce their unmatched total before their opponent .

Rummy : What's the Difference ?
While both this card game and Gin Rummy share a similar foundation , there are significant distinctions . Rummy is a broader category that encompasses many variants , often involving melding sets and sequences. Gin Rummy, on the different hand, is a particular type of the card game played with a concentration on quickly accumulating points through minimizing remaining cards – called “deadwood” – and attempting to “knock” before your opponent . Essentially, Gin Rummy is a more streamlined and faster experience than many typical this card game games .
